What was the first analog device?
model 101 op amp
History. The company was founded by two MIT graduates, Ray Stata and Matthew Lorber in 1965. The same year, the company released its first product, the model 101 op amp, which was a hockey-puck sized module used in test and measurement equipment.

Who founded Analog Devices?
Ray Stata
Analog Devices/Founders
Over 50 years ago, two MIT graduates, Ray Stata and Matthew Lorber, launched a new company, which they called Analog Devices. Their focus was the manufacture of high performance operational amplifiers – which as the name would suggest, precisely amplified and modified electrical signals – a newly developing market.
Where does Analog Devices manufacture?
Analog Devices has two manufacturing sites; a 150mm wafer fab in Wilmington, Massachusetts and a 200mm wafer fab in Limerick, Ireland.

Who is the CEO of Analog Devices?
Vincent Roche (Mar 28, 2013–)
Analog Devices/CEO
As President, Chief Executive Officer, and member of the Board of Directors, Vincent Roche sets Analog Devices’ strategic vision and oversees operational execution across the business.
Is Analog Devices a good company?
Analog Devices, Inc. (ADI) has been named one of world’s best employers and a top place to work in Massachusetts, highlighting its commitment to be an employer of choice. Analog Devices was included in Forbes’ World’s Best Employers 2020 list.
What products do Analog Devices make?
We currently produce a wide range of innovative products—including data converters, amplifiers and linear products, radio frequency (RF) ICs, power management products, sensors based on microelectromechanical systems (MEMS) technology and other sensors, and processing products, including DSP and other processors—that …
